Réserve forestière de Diécké Weather by Month: Complete Twelve-Month Climate Record

Examine the complete twelve-month climate baseline for Réserve forestière de Diécké across average temperature bounds and average daily precipitation rates. Compare relative humidity, wind speed, and calculated daylight hours to understand the full annual climatology at a representative coordinate.
Mean temperaturePrecipitationHumidityWind speedDaylight
January24.4 °C14.4° to 34.8°0.5 mm/day56.3%1.4 m/s11.6 hours
February26.1 °C16.6° to 36.4°1.5 mm/day61.2%1.3 m/s11.8 hours
March26.3 °C19.4° to 35.8°3.3 mm/day72.6%1.2 m/s12 hours
April25.8 °C20.7° to 34.2°5.1 mm/day80%1.2 m/s12.2 hours
May25.2 °C20.7° to 32.1°6.2 mm/day84.8%1.2 m/s12.3 hours
June24.2 °C19.9° to 30.6°8 mm/day87.3%1.3 m/s12.4 hours
July23 °C19° to 29.4°7.3 mm/day88.5%1.5 m/s12.4 hours
August22.7 °C18.8° to 28.8°9.8 mm/day89.9%1.7 m/s12.2 hours
September23.3 °C19.4° to 29.2°9.9 mm/day89.9%1.3 m/s12 hours
October24 °C19.6° to 29.8°6.8 mm/day87.6%1.1 m/s11.8 hours
November24.2 °C18° to 30.5°2.7 mm/day82.9%1.1 m/s11.7 hours
December23.6 °C14.5° to 32.3°0.7 mm/day69.1%1.3 m/s11.6 hours
